




版權說明:本文檔由用戶提供并上傳,收益歸屬內容提供方,若內容存在侵權,請進行舉報或認領
文檔簡介
并發場景下用戶權限控制策略并發場景下用戶權限控制策略在現代信息系統中,用戶權限控制是保障系統安全性和數據完整性的關鍵環節。特別是在并發場景下,用戶權限控制策略的有效實施對于防止數據沖突、保護用戶隱私以及維護系統穩定性至關重要。本文將探討并發場景下用戶權限控制策略的重要性、挑戰以及實現途徑。一、并發場景下用戶權限控制概述并發場景指的是在同一時間內,多個用戶或進程同時對系統資源進行訪問和操作的情況。在這種場景下,用戶權限控制策略需要確保每個用戶只能訪問和操作他們被授權的資源,同時防止未授權的訪問和操作。有效的用戶權限控制策略能夠確保系統的安全性、穩定性和高效性。1.1并發場景下用戶權限控制的核心特性并發場景下用戶權限控制的核心特性主要包括以下幾個方面:-實時性:權限控制策略需要能夠實時響應用戶的訪問請求,確保權限的即時性和準確性。-一致性:在多個用戶并發訪問時,權限控制策略需要保證數據的一致性和完整性,防止數據沖突和錯誤。-靈活性:權限控制策略需要能夠適應不同的業務場景和用戶需求,提供靈活的權限設置和管理。-可擴展性:隨著系統規模的擴大和用戶數量的增加,權限控制策略需要具有良好的可擴展性,以適應不斷變化的系統需求。1.2并發場景下用戶權限控制的應用場景并發場景下用戶權限控制的應用場景非常廣泛,包括但不限于以下幾個方面:-多用戶協作系統:在多用戶協作系統中,不同的用戶可能需要訪問和操作相同的數據資源,權限控制策略需要確保每個用戶只能訪問他們被授權的部分。-在線交易平臺:在線交易平臺需要處理大量的并發交易請求,權限控制策略需要確保交易的安全性和數據的一致性。-社交網絡平臺:社交網絡平臺需要處理大量的并發用戶交互,權限控制策略需要保護用戶隱私和數據安全。-企業資源規劃系統:企業資源規劃系統需要處理多個部門和員工的并發訪問,權限控制策略需要確保數據的安全性和業務流程的順暢。二、并發場景下用戶權限控制的挑戰并發場景下用戶權限控制面臨著多方面的挑戰,這些挑戰需要通過有效的策略和技術手段來克服。2.1數據一致性問題在并發場景下,多個用戶或進程可能同時對同一數據資源進行讀寫操作,這可能導致數據不一致的問題。例如,兩個用戶同時更新同一數據項,可能會導致最終的數據狀態不確定。為了解決這個問題,權限控制策略需要結合事務管理和鎖定機制,確保數據的一致性和完整性。2.2安全性問題并發場景下,用戶權限控制需要面對各種安全威脅,包括未授權訪問、數據泄露、服務拒絕等。為了提高系統的安全性,權限控制策略需要結合身份驗證、訪問控制、加密和審計等多種安全機制。2.3性能問題在高并發場景下,權限控制策略可能會成為系統性能的瓶頸。大量的權限檢查和驗證操作可能會降低系統的響應速度和吞吐量。為了提高性能,權限控制策略需要優化算法和數據結構,減少不必要的權限檢查,同時利用緩存和并行處理技術提高處理效率。2.4復雜性問題隨著系統規模的擴大和業務需求的變化,用戶權限控制的復雜性也在不斷增加。權限控制策略需要管理成千上萬的用戶和權限設置,同時需要適應不同的業務場景和合規要求。為了降低復雜性,權限控制策略需要提供靈活的權限模型和自動化的管理工具,以簡化權限的設置和管理。三、并發場景下用戶權限控制策略的實現途徑并發場景下用戶權限控制策略的實現需要綜合考慮技術、管理和法律等多個方面的因素。3.1技術實現技術實現是并發場景下用戶權限控制策略的核心部分,主要包括以下幾個方面:-身份驗證和訪問控制:通過身份驗證確保用戶身份的真實性,通過訪問控制確保用戶只能訪問他們被授權的資源。-角色基于的訪問控制(RBAC):通過定義角色和權限的映射關系,簡化權限的分配和管理。-屬性基于的訪問控制(ABAC):通過定義屬性和權限的映射關系,實現更細粒度的權限控制。-細粒度鎖和事務管理:通過細粒度鎖和事務管理機制,確保數據的一致性和完整性。-加密和審計:通過加密保護數據的安全性,通過審計跟蹤和分析用戶的訪問行為。3.2管理實現管理實現是并發場景下用戶權限控制策略的重要補充,主要包括以下幾個方面:-權限管理策略:制定明確的權限管理策略,明確權限的分配、審核和撤銷流程。-用戶培訓和意識提升:通過培訓和教育提高用戶對權限控制重要性的認識,提升用戶的安全意識。-合規性和審計:確保權限控制策略符合相關的法律法規要求,通過審計檢查權限控制的執行情況。3.3法律和政策支持法律和政策支持為并發場景下用戶權限控制策略提供了法律依據和政策指導,主要包括以下幾個方面:-數據保護法規:遵守數據保護法規,保護用戶數據的安全和隱私。-網絡安全法規:遵守網絡安全法規,提高系統的安全性和抗攻擊能力。-行業標準和最佳實踐:參考行業標準和最佳實踐,提高權限控制策略的有效性和適應性。通過上述的技術、管理和法律等多個方面的綜合實施,可以有效地實現并發場景下用戶權限控制策略,保障系統的安全性、穩定性和高效性。四、并發場景下用戶權限控制的高級策略隨著技術的發展和業務需求的復雜化,傳統的用戶權限控制策略已經不能完全滿足并發場景下的需求。因此,需要引入一些高級策略來增強權限控制的效果。4.1動態權限調整在并發場景下,用戶的需求和系統的狀態是動態變化的。動態權限調整策略可以根據用戶的行為模式、系統負載和安全威脅等因素,實時調整用戶的權限設置。這種策略可以利用機器學習和數據分析技術,自動識別權限調整的需求,并自動執行權限調整操作。4.2權限沖突檢測與解決在并發環境中,不同用戶或進程可能會對同一資源提出相互沖突的權限請求。權限沖突檢測與解決策略可以識別這些沖突,并采取相應的措施來解決沖突,例如,通過優先級規則、時間戳排序或協商機制來決定哪個請求應該被優先滿足。4.3細粒度的權限分解傳統的權限控制往往采用較為粗放的權限設置,這在并發場景下可能導致權限的濫用或不足。細粒度的權限分解策略可以將權限細分到更具體的操作和數據項,從而提供更精確的權限控制。例如,對于一個文檔,可以細分為讀取、編輯、刪除、共享等不同的權限,而不是簡單的讀寫權限。4.4跨系統權限管理在多系統環境中,用戶可能需要在不同的系統之間切換工作。跨系統權限管理策略可以確保用戶在不同系統間保持一致的權限設置,同時避免權限的重復管理和沖突。這通常需要一個集中的權限管理平臺來協調不同系統間的權限設置。五、并發場景下用戶權限控制的技術實現細節技術實現是并發場景下用戶權限控制策略的核心,以下是一些關鍵的技術實現細節。5.1基于策略的訪問控制基于策略的訪問控制(PBAC)是一種靈活的權限管理方式,它允許根據預定義的安全策略來動態地授予或拒絕訪問請求。這些策略可以基于用戶的角色、屬性、環境因素等多種條件,以確保在并發場景下做出合理的訪問控制決策。5.2分布式權限管理在分布式系統中,權限管理需要跨多個節點進行。分布式權限管理技術可以確保在不同節點間一致的權限控制,同時提高系統的可擴展性和容錯性。這通常涉及到分布式數據庫、一致性協議和分布式鎖等技術。5.3權限緩存機制為了提高并發處理能力,可以在系統中實現權限緩存機制。通過緩存用戶的權限狀態,可以減少對權限數據庫的訪問次數,從而提高系統的響應速度。當然,緩存機制需要合理設計,以確保在用戶權限變更時能夠及時更新緩存。5.4權限變更的實時通知在并發場景下,用戶權限的變更需要實時通知到所有相關的系統和用戶。這可以通過消息隊列、事件驅動架構或WebSocket等技術實現。實時通知機制可以確保系統狀態的一致性,并減少因權限變更延遲帶來的問題。六、并發場景下用戶權限控制的實踐案例理論需要與實踐相結合,以下是一些并發場景下用戶權限控制的實踐案例。6.1電商平臺的用戶權限控制電商平臺需要處理大量的并發用戶訪問和交易。在這種場景下,用戶權限控制不僅需要保護用戶數據的安全,還需要確保交易的順利進行。例如,用戶在下單時,系統需要驗證用戶的支付權限,并在庫存并發更新時保持數據的一致性。6.2云服務提供商的權限隔離云服務提供商需要在多租戶環境中隔離不同客戶的數據和權限。通過實施基于角色的訪問控制和屬性基于的訪問控制,云服務提供商可以確保每個客戶只能訪問自己的資源,同時提供靈活的權限管理以適應不同客戶的需求。6.3金融機構的并發交易控制金融機構在處理并發交易時,需要嚴格的權限控制來防止欺詐和錯誤。通過實施細粒度的權限分解和實時的權限變更通知,金融機構可以確保交易的安全性和合規性。6.4社交網絡的信息流控制社交網絡需要處理大量的并發信息流和用戶交互。通過實施動態權限調整和跨系統權限管理,社交網絡可以確保用戶隱私的保護,同時提供個性化的內容推薦。總結并發場景下的用戶權限控制是一個復雜而多維的問題,它涉及到技術、管理和法律等多個層面。有效的用戶權限控制策略需要實時性、一致性、靈活性和可擴展性等核心
溫馨提示
- 1. 本站所有資源如無特殊說明,都需要本地電腦安裝OFFICE2007和PDF閱讀器。圖紙軟件為CAD,CAXA,PROE,UG,SolidWorks等.壓縮文件請下載最新的WinRAR軟件解壓。
- 2. 本站的文檔不包含任何第三方提供的附件圖紙等,如果需要附件,請聯系上傳者。文件的所有權益歸上傳用戶所有。
- 3. 本站RAR壓縮包中若帶圖紙,網頁內容里面會有圖紙預覽,若沒有圖紙預覽就沒有圖紙。
- 4. 未經權益所有人同意不得將文件中的內容挪作商業或盈利用途。
- 5. 人人文庫網僅提供信息存儲空間,僅對用戶上傳內容的表現方式做保護處理,對用戶上傳分享的文檔內容本身不做任何修改或編輯,并不能對任何下載內容負責。
- 6. 下載文件中如有侵權或不適當內容,請與我們聯系,我們立即糾正。
- 7. 本站不保證下載資源的準確性、安全性和完整性, 同時也不承擔用戶因使用這些下載資源對自己和他人造成任何形式的傷害或損失。
最新文檔
- 網絡推廣試題及答案
- 2025年醫藥物流保溫協議范本
- 2025年物流配送合作策劃協議草案
- 2025年員工福利權益放棄策劃協議
- 商業空間節假日旅游市場調研規劃基礎知識點歸納
- 創客教育理念在語文課堂中的實踐與反思
- 理賠業務風險培訓成本風險基礎知識點歸納
- 農業生物技術創新與食品安全保障
- 醫體融合促進康復醫療產業發展的路徑
- 老舊市政供水管網更新改造項目工程方案
- 《城市軌道交通列車電氣系統》全套教學課件
- 2025年新北師大版數學七年級下冊課件 第五章 5.1 軸對稱及其性質
- 泳池救生員知識培訓課件
- 2025年全球及中國橋梁健康監測行業頭部企業市場占有率及排名調研報告
- 2025年基本公共衛生服務人員培訓計劃
- 一年級語文上冊口語交際-小白兔運南瓜
- 大數據技術原理與應用-林子雨版-課后習題答案(文檔).文檔
- 2020-2024年高考語文真題語病題匯編及解析
- 供應商審核表
- 國開電大《財務報表分析》形考任務1-4
- 廉潔進校園知識競賽參考題庫200題(含答案)
評論
0/150
提交評論